In a total of around 80 specific biome colors I have gathered 50 of them, The rest being unnecessary for this thread.
The highlighted biomes are the ones being used:
(sorry, as snipping tool failed to work will edit this tomorrow)
All the highlighted biomes in order from up to down follow a number sequence. Just the simple one like 1,2,3,4 etc. So ocean = 01, plains = 02 and mesa plateau M = 50. If you want to spawn on a mushroom island, Then you put in the seed box any numbers you like as long as the first 2 numbers are 11. The seed can be "11", it can be "11568" or it can be "1156874". Ether seed will be different, but will still spawn you on a mushroom biome. This goes for any of the highlighted biomes as well.
Seeds would have to be configured differently, and would require a new set of seed coding. I don't see how this could not be possible to implement. Please give any concerns as I am not a minecraft seed wiz.

Get the world seed before the generation, turn it into a string (text), substring it by 2 characters (remove first 2 numbers in a string), return the modified seed and set that as the default seed, and by using substring you could get the first 2 characters too and then set the original biome, this would be especially easy since 1.8, because you have custom world generation.
